Optimal Heat Level Consistency

Maintaining stable temperatures stands as the foremost advantage of a dedicated wine storage system. Variations in cold subject stoppers to expansion, permitting oxygen infiltration that causes spoilage. A premium wine cooler eradicates this hazard by holding settings typically ranging from 45°F and 65°F, customizable for red or champagne types. Such accuracy ensures every vessel stays at its perfect storage state indefinitely.

Standard refrigerators operate at lower temperatures, commonly near 37°F, which suppresses flavor evolution and renders tannins unpleasant. Additionally, their regular cycling creates harmful shifts in internal climate. A wine cooler’s thermoelectric mechanism counteracts this by providing gradual chilling without abrupt changes, protecting the integrity of vintage bottles.

Humidity Control Basics

Proper moisture levels play a crucial role in preventing cork deterioration. If stoppers dehydrate, they shrink, permitting oxygen entry that spoils the vino. Alternatively, high dampness encourages mold formation on identifiers and packaging. A well-designed wine cooler maintains 50-80% optimal moisture, a range impossible to achieve in dry kitchen settings.

Such balance is accomplished via built-in moisture systems that track and adjust levels seamlessly. In contrast to standard refrigerators, which remove moisture from the atmosphere, wine coolers preserve essential wetness to maintain closures flexible and sealed. This feature is especially vital for extended cellaring, where minor variations cause permanent loss.

Protection from Light and Vibration

UV rays and oscillations present silent yet significant threats to wine quality. Contact to natural light breaks down chemical compounds in wine, resulting in early aging and "unpleasant" flavors. Moreover, constant vibrations agitate particles, hastening chemical reactions that lessen depth. A wine refrigerator counters these problems with tinted doors and anti-vibration mechanisms.

High-end units feature dual-paned entryways that filter 99% of harmful UV rays, creating a dark sanctuary for stored bottles. At the same time, sophisticated compressor technologies employ shock-absorbing supports or thermoelectric configurations to eliminate motor vibrations. This dual protection ensures fragile years remain undisturbed by outside factors.

Space Optimization and Organization

Clutter hampers efficient wine management, causing to forgotten bottles or accidental damage. A Beverage wine cooler addresses this with adjustable shelving designed for diverse bottle dimensions. Wooden shelves prevent scratches, while slanted designs showcase labels for easy identification. Furthermore, modular arrangements maximize height space in compact rooms.

In extensive collections, zoning capabilities allow separate climate zones within a single appliance. This flexibility permits simultaneous keeping of white, sparkling, and dessert wines at their respective ideal climates. Such structuring transforms chaotic cellars into elegant, user-friendly exhibitions, enhancing both utility and visual attractiveness.

Energy Efficiency and Sustainability

Modern wine coolers emphasize energy efficiency absent sacrificing functionality. Innovations like LED illumination, enhanced insulation, and variable-speed compressors significantly lower electricity consumption compared to traditional models. Many appliances hold ENERGY STAR® ratings, indicating compliance to strict environmental standards.

Such economy translates to long-term cost reduction and a reduced ecological footprint. Contrary to standard freezers, which cycle frequently, wine coolers engage refrigeration only when needed, maintaining climates with low power draw. Additionally, sustainable coolants lessen ozone damage, resonating with environmentally aware values.
